相关文章
529. 扫雷游戏 DFS
529. 扫雷游戏
2020/8/20每日一题打卡√
题目描述 解题思路
感觉这个题最难的点还是在于理解题意和样例 理解了之后就很明确了,就是正常的DFS 如果点击了雷,就爆炸 如果没点到雷,就判断这个位置旁边有没有雷;如果有雷ÿ…
建站知识
2025/1/1 23:04:16
uva 529 - Addition Chains
此题使用迭代加深搜索。。
注意:1.首先确定最少的步数
2.剪枝:获得当前数t之后。。。看 t * 2(的maxd -d次方)能不能大于n,反之则不用再dfs下去了。 //
// main.cpp
// uva 529 - Addition Chains
//
// Created by XD on 15/8/8.
// Copyright (c) 2015年…
建站知识
2024/12/3 0:03:21
【ID搜索】uva529Addition Chains
题目描述:对于一个数列{a},任意一个数都比前面的数大,且是前面任意两个数(可以是同一个数)之和。a01。求得到n的最短数列(最优解不为一)。 样例: 输入 5 7 12 15 77 0 输出…
建站知识
2025/1/19 14:22:11
java 中\u767b\u5f55\u6210\u529f编码转成明文
new String("\u767b\u5f55\u6210\u529f".getBytes(),"utf-8")
如果不是utf-8,则可以替换成 unicode
建站知识
2025/1/7 4:11:36
[VRFC 10-529] concurrent assignment to a non-net an is not permitted [C:/Users/chenxy/Desktop/digit
[VRFC 10-529] concurrent assignment to a non-net an is not permitted ["C:/Users/chenxy/Desktop/digit,
这个错误的意思是,对一个非网口类型的 an 同时赋值是不被允许的,也就是说,你在多个模块里都存在对an赋值的情况&…
建站知识
2025/1/3 13:04:19
leetcode:529. 扫雷游戏【节点分类,dfs,越界,分类判断,例题】
分析
1.八个方向找地雷 2.越界判断 3.当前是否是地雷计数1or0 4.当前节点的八个周边有几个雷 5.dfs节点,若越界or不是E就返回了,否则看地雷数;若没有地雷,则标志B,并dfs;否则标记地雷数 6.外部,…
建站知识
2024/12/4 0:30:18
529day(ajax-post.html)
《2019年3月17日》【连续529天】
标题:ajax-post.html; 内容:
<!DOCTYPE html>
<html lang"en">
<head><meta charset"UTF-8"><title>AJAX发送POST请求</title><style>#loa…
建站知识
2024/12/4 19:50:45
LC.529. 扫雷游戏(DFS)
LC.529. 扫雷游戏(DFS)
思路: d f s dfs dfs即可,需要注意的是这里的相邻是 8 8 8连通。
class Solution {
public:int sx,sy,vis[55][55],n,m;//int d[4][2]{0,1,0,-1,1,0,-1,0};int d[8][2]{0,1,0,-1,1,0,-1,0,1,1,1,-1,-1,-1,-1,1};bool jg(int x,int y){retur…
建站知识
2024/12/26 9:04:27